BIO.B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review
5 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Bio-Rad Laboratories Class B (BIO.B)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$4.16M — up 2.1% from $4.07M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in BIO.B was balanced in Q4 2015: 0 funds opened new positions, 0 closed out, 1 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Barclays, adding an estimated $23.1K. The largest seller was Citigroup, cutting an estimated $553.
